I both agree and disagree with you. I agree that the answer was a good one in the real-world sense, and one that I would like an engineer to use under the right circumstances. I disagree that the answer demonstrated engineering prowess, however. Sometimes you have to assume the lack of existence of certain tools to understand how a candidate would have implemented the solution him- or herself to get a more thorough understanding of his or her engineering chops. |
